Subject: Handover — Lintbarge image slimming

Taking over release duties for Lintbarge while Priya's out. Image slimming branch is ready for review: base swapped to minimal runtime, build deps stripped, final image down from 1.2GB to 310MB. Multi-stage build verified on staging. Watch for the missing CA bundle issue — fixed in layer three. Signed manifests are required before promoting to the registry. Use the signing key below when you push the release.

deploy key for kajof-fajop: bky6_gDHw9Q

Spare keyboards, monitors, cables, and docking stations for the Quillbank team are kept in Storage Room 3B, next to the east stairwell on Level 3. Team assistants may take items as needed but should update the stock sheet on the shelf inside the door. The room stays locked at all times. To enter, use the door code below.

staff pass of kawip-hawef = bdg-QLP-2

## Releases

Ledgerpine report exports now normalize all timestamps to the tenant's configured timezone before rendering, rather than relying on the export host's locale. Reviewers should verify DST boundaries in the fixture suite, especially the half-hour offset cases. Release artifacts are built reproducibly and signed prior to publishing. Verify each tarball against the signing key shown here.

deploy key for kaduf-bagep: bky6_NNeq4d

## Runbook: logtail-cli quick reference

Use `logtail` to stream service logs from the Vexor cluster. Common flags: `--service`, `--since`, `--grep`. Tailing defaults to the last 15 minutes.

If output stalls, check the broker pod first; restart only after confirming lag metrics. Do not tail more than three services concurrently on shared nodes.

For audit-mode queries, the CLI reads directly from the archive database. Connect using the string below.

primary connection of yagep-kahip = redis://giliel_svc:zYiKsLL2PLpfPL@db-348f.xolmarsys.corp:5432/fenwyn